Health, Safety, and Environmental Manager

Responsible for developing, implementing, and maintaining company-wide health, safety, and environmental (HSE) programs.

Ensures compliance with OSHA, EPA, and ISO standards while promoting a culture of safety awareness and continuous improvement.

Partners with all departments to reduce risks, train employees, and prevent incidents.

Supports a multi-shift manufacturing operation and must be available for off-shift incidents when needed (standard schedule: Monday–Friday).

Develop, implement, and maintain safety and environmental policies, procedures, and compliance programs.

Conduct routine safety inspections, risk assessments, and audits to identify and correct hazards.

Investigate incidents, near misses, and accidents, documenting findings and implementing corrective actions.

Facilitate safety committee meetings and lead cross-functional initiatives that strengthen safety culture.

Develop and deliver employee training on OSHA compliance, emergency response, and environmental regulations.

Track and report safety metrics, audit results, and compliance documentation accurately and on time.

Monitor safety and environmental performance indicators, analyzing trends to recommend improvements.

Plan and coordinate emergency drills and oversee emergency preparedness programs.

Communicate with regulatory agencies to maintain compliance with local, state, and federal requirements.

Manage workers' compensation claims and coordinate return-to-work efforts with HR.

Lead internal audits for ISO 45001 (Occupational Safety) and ISO 14001 (Environmental Management).

Partner with operations leadership to proactively address safety hazards and improve work conditions.
